Arriving at Penarth station, you'll find a variety of facilities aimed at making your journey smooth and stress-free. The ticket office is open throughout the week, with an early start on weekdays to accommodate early commuters. The station is equipped with ticket machines that are accessible, accepting payments exclusively via credit or debit cards. For those who prefer collecting their tickets in person, this is possible via the machines or the ticket office, as smartcards are not issued here.
Penarth station is fully accessible, with step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for all passengers. Helpful information is readily available from the ticket office staff or via the customer help points spread across the station. The attentive service continues with Passenger Assist, a program designed to facilitate travel for those requiring additional support.
Although the station lacks amenities such as refreshment facilities, shops, or Wi-Fi, passengers can find seating areas and weather-protected bicycle storage. Cyclists are well-catered for, with sheltered stands and CCTV monitored areas for peace of mind.
Connectivity doesn't end at the station, as Penarth offers diverse onward travel options. The rail replacement bus service and bicycle hire make getting around town and surrounding areas straightforward. The local bus services on Stanwell Road, where these buses pick up and drop off passengers, provide additional flexibility for getting to your next destination.

Walmer station boasts a range of facilities to ensure that your travel experience is as smooth as possible. With a bustling ticket office open every weekday and Saturday from 06:30 to 11:00, obtaining your desired rail tickets is straightforward. Ticket machines are available for your convenience, including accessible machines positioned on platform 1 for ease of access. While Walmer issues smartcards, it’s worth noting that smartcard validators are not present at the station.
For those in need of assistance, the station offers robust support with accessible help points and ramp access to trains. Although step-free access is provided to platform 1 and the side entrance from Sydney Road, a subway with steps connects the platforms, requiring extra caution for those with reduced mobility.
Walmer train station serves as a convenient hub for onward journeys. If alternative travel is necessary, a rail replacement service towards Deal and Dover can be accessed via the nearby Court Road bus stops.
